Probably not: There are no controlled studies of antidepressants in pregnancy, which would compare them to women who are pregnant and not on the medication, so to my knowledge, there is no good research to say one way or the other. In my practice, in my reading of the research, about one fifth of pregnancies end in miscarriage, so it's very difficult to tell what the causes are. Talk to your OB.
